处理机调度实验报告_第1页
处理机调度实验报告_第2页
处理机调度实验报告_第3页
处理机调度实验报告_第4页
处理机调度实验报告_第5页
已阅读5页,还剩27页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

处理机调度实验报告目录CONTENTS实验目的实验环境实验过程实验结果实验结论参考文献01CHAPTER实验目的理解处理机调度的基本概念总结词处理机调度是操作系统中一项重要的任务,它负责决定在某一时刻,哪个进程或线程应该被分配给处理机执行。处理机调度主要涉及以下几个方面:作业调度、进程调度和线程调度。作业调度主要关注作业的提交、排队和执行;进程调度关注进程的切换和执行;线程调度则关注线程的执行和调度。详细描述理解处理机调度的基本概念掌握处理机调度的基本算法掌握处理机调度的基本算法总结词处理机调度的基本算法包括先来先服务(FCFS)、最短作业优先(SJF)、最短剩余时间优先(SRTF)、最高响应比优先(HRRN)等。这些算法各有特点,适用场景也不同。例如,FCFS算法简单易实现,适用于作业数量较少的情况;SJF算法则能更好地利用系统资源,适用于作业数量较多且作业长度差异较大的情况。详细描述总结词理解不同调度算法对系统性能的影响要点一要点二详细描述不同的调度算法对系统性能的影响主要体现在以下几个方面:响应时间、吞吐量、等待时间、处理器利用率等。例如,SJF算法可以减少等待时间,提高系统吞吐量;而SRTF算法则能减少响应时间,提高系统响应速度。在实际应用中,需要根据具体需求和场景选择合适的调度算法,以达到最佳的系统性能。理解不同调度算法对系统性能的影响02CHAPTER实验环境IntelCorei7-8700K,主频3.7GHz处理器16GBDDR4RAM内存256GBSSD存储Ubuntu18.04操作系统硬件环境软件环境编译器实验调度软件数据采集工具SiemensS7-1200PLC编程软件Python脚本和传感器网络GCC8.3.0数据来源传感器网络实时采集的设备运行数据数据存储存储在MySQL数据库中,以便后续分析和挖掘数据处理使用Python脚本进行数据清洗、预处理和可视化实验数据03CHAPTER实验过程实验过程实验步骤步骤一:实验准备确定实验目标:本实验旨在研究不同调度算法对处理机调度的性能影响。选择调度算法:选择先进先出(FIFO)、最短作业优先(SJF)和优先级调度算法作为研究对象。实验过程实验步骤01准备实验环境:配置处理机、操作系统和相关软件。02步骤二:数据收集运行实验:在相同环境下,使用不同调度算法处理一系列作业。03010203数据记录:记录每个作业的到达时间、执行时间、等待时间和周转时间。数据整理:对收集到的数据进行整理,以便后续分析。步骤三:结果分析实验过程实验步骤对比不同调度算法下的作业完成情况、平均等待时间和平均周转时间。数据分析使用图表展示实验结果,便于直观比较。结果可视化根据数据分析结果,得出调度算法的性能优劣。结论总结实验过程实验步骤04CHAPTER实验结果总结词:执行时间详细描述:通过对不同调度算法的执行时间进行比较,我们发现先进先出(FIFO)算法的执行时间最长,最短作业优先(SJF)算法的执行时间最短。这是因为SJF算法能够根据作业的长度动态调整调度顺序,从而更有效地利用处理机资源。不同调度算法的执行时间比较总结词:等待时间详细描述:在等待时间方面,最短作业优先(SJF)算法同样表现最佳,因为它优先调度长度最短的作业,减少了等待时间。先进先出(FIFO)算法的等待时间最长,因为它不考虑作业长度,按照到达顺序进行调度。不同调度算法的等待时间比较VS总结词:周转时间详细描述:周转时间反映了作业从提交到完成所需的总时间。在周转时间方面,最短作业优先(SJF)算法同样表现最佳,因为它能够更快地完成作业,减少了总体等待和执行时间。先进先出(FIFO)算法的周转时间最长,因为其执行时间长且等待时间也较长。不同调度算法的周转时间比较05CHAPTER实验结论调度算法对系统性能的影响显著影响调度算法的选择对系统性能具有显著影响。不同的调度算法可能导致系统吞吐量、等待时间和周转时间等性能指标出现较大差异。优化效果通过实验分析,某些调度算法在特定情况下能够显著优化系统性能。例如,最短作业优先(SJF)算法在作业长短差异较大时能取得较好的效果。调度算法对系统性能的影响调度算法对系统性能的影响适用场景不同的调度算法适用于不同的场景。例如,SJF适用于作业长短差异较大的情况,而轮转法适用于作业长短相近或要求响应时间较短的情况。资源消耗调度算法的执行也会带来一定的资源消耗,如CPU时间和内存占用。在选择调度算法时,需要考虑其对系统资源的占用情况。调度算法对系统性能的影响实验环境限制本实验的局限性在于实验环境与实际生产环境可能存在差异,导致实验结果在实际应用中的适用性受到限制。本实验的局限性样本数量限制由于实验资源和时间的限制,本实验的样本数量相对较小,可能无法完全反映真实情况下的性能差异。本实验的局限性参数设置限制实验中的参数设置可能没有涵盖所有可能的配置,因此实验结果可能无法反映所有可能的性能变化。本实验的局限性未考虑动态变化本实验未考虑系统负载的动态变化对调度算法性能的影响,实际应用中系统负载的动态变化是一个重要因素。本实验的局限性对未来研究的建议扩展实验环境建议未来研究扩展实验环境,以更接近实际生产环境,提高实验结果的适用性。增加样本数量考虑动态变化建议未来研究考虑系统负载的动态变化对调度算法性能的影响,以更准确地反映实际应用中的情况。建议未来研究增加样本数量,以更全面地评估调度算法的性能差异。06CHAPTER参考文献[参考1]该文献详细介绍了处理机调度的基本原理和算法,包括先来先服务、最短作业优先、优先级调度等算法的原理和实现方式。该文献还通过实验验证了这些算法的性能和适用场景,为后续的研究提供了重要的参考。[参考2]该文献重点研究了处理机调度中的公平性问题。通过建立数学模型和进行实验分析,该文献提出了一种新的公平性调度算法,该算法在保证公平

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论